The Department
of Applied Chemistry offers the undergraduate program that leads to the
Bachelor of Science degree in chemistry (B.S.). This undergraduate program is
designed for students who intend to pursue advanced degrees in chemistry or
other related fields. Students who enroll in this program are able to work as
chemists in industry, government laboratories, or other related companies.
Trainings,
including the theoretical and experimental aspects, for undergraduate students
cover all the subdisciplines in chemistry. Students normally take required
courses during their freshman and sophomore years. After they are knowledgeable
in organic, inorganic, physical, analytical chemistry, and biochemistry, they
are offered many research opportunities in their senior years. Thus, students
are able to receive appropriate guidance from our dedicated faculty to develop
their independent research abilities.
To prepare our
students for further advanced studies or better curriculum opportunities,
students are required to take at least three lecture courses from a list of
core courses in their junior and senior years. These core courses cover the
basic and the most updated knowledge in material science and biotechnology.
After completing the program, our students are able to immediately devote
themselves in related researches or jobs with minimum training.
